Abstract
The utility model discloses a high-accuracy fingerprint identifier, comprising a microprocessor MCU, fingerprint acquisition sensor, a USB communication interface, a data security management module, a fingerprint comparison authentication module and a digital certificate authentication module, wherein the fingerprint acquisition sensor and the USB communication interface are respectively connected with the microprocessor MCU; the data security management module, the fingerprint comparison authentication module and the digital certificate authentication module are respectively connected with the microprocessor MCU; and the microprocessor MCU comprises a data encryption and decryption unit, a certificate storage and download unit, a key management unit, a digital signature management unit and a basic cryptographic algorithm acquiring unit. The time for comparing one group for the fingerprints high-accuracy fingerprint identifier is less than 1.5s so that the high-accuracy fingerprint identifier has quick identifying speed; for the high-accuracy fingerprint identifier, the probability for false identification is less than 0.001% and the probability for refusing identification is less than 0.01%, thus having high identification accuracy and high reliability; and the storage space is larger so that the data for 30 fingerprints can stored for one time.

Background technology
Fingerprint Identification Unit is widely used in work attendance, gate control system, concerning security matters resource management system, electronic government affairs system and numerous areas such as government, military organs, and it has advantages such as simple to operation and long service life.But there is following problem in existing Fingerprint Identification Unit: comparing two fingerprints usually needs the time about 2S, and recognition speed is slower; Occur that mistake is known and to refuse the probability of situation such as knowing still higher, lower, the poor reliability of accuracy of identification; Storage space is limited, and storable finger print information is less.
